计算 B 列中相对于 A 列的唯一值

计算 B 列中相对于 A 列的唯一值

我在 Microsoft Excel 中有两列,A 和 B。输入显示如下

A      B
ABC    1
ABC    1
ABC    2
ABC    2
ABC    2
DEF    1
DEF    3
DEF    3
CDE    1
CDE    2
CDE    3
CDE    4

我需要一个像下面这样的输出,其含义也得到了解释

ABC   2.....which means (two unique values with ABC, which is 1 & 2)
DEF   2......(1 & 3)
CDE   4.......(1,2,3,4)

答案1

在 C1 中使用公式创建第三列=A1 & B1并向下复制粘贴。

之后,您可以使用公式(在表格中给出计数)对它们进行计数,或者制作数据透视表。因此,您的两个选项如下:

  • 在单元格 D1 中,使用公式=COUNTIF(C:C;"=" & C1并将其复制粘贴下来。
  • 根据前三列创建一个数据透视表,并将 C 列中的数据放入数据透视表的列中,并将其频率放入数据透视表的值中。

答案2

如果你可以对它们进行排序,那么请在其中添加一列:=IF(A3=A2,SIGN(B3-B2),1)

然后只需输入一个小计。:)

相关内容